Skincare refers to a range of practices, products, and treatments designed to enhance the health and appearance of the skin. A comprehensive skincare routine helps maintain the skin’s natural balance, addresses specific concerns, and protects it from environmental damage and aging.

Skincare Results Overview

Achieving better skincare results starts with consistency and the right approach tailored to your skin type and concerns. Begin with a simple routine that includes cleansing, moisturizing, and sun protection. Adding targeted treatments, such as serums with Vitamin C for brightening or retinoids for anti-aging, can amplify results over time.

Exfoliation is key to revealing smoother, glowing skin, but it should be done 1-2 times a week to avoid irritation. Hydration is equally vital; look for products with hyaluronic acid or ceramides to strengthen your skin barrier.

For faster and more visible results, consider professional treatments like facials, chemical peels, or LED light therapy. These can address deeper concerns such as acne scars, fine lines, or uneven texture.

Remember, skincare is a journey. Combining the right products, a balanced lifestyle, and professional guidance will leave your skin looking healthier, radiant, and rejuvenated.
